As a Residential Security Technician, you will be responsible for installing, servicing, and troubleshooting home security systems. After completing a paid multi-week training program, you will work independently in customers’ homes to install and program security equipment while delivering a high level of customer service.

Responsibilities

  • Install and program burglar alarm systems, CCTV systems (IP & analog), DVRs, and basic access control equipment
  • Install door and window contacts, motion sensors, glass break detectors, smoke detectors, and other add-on components
  • Troubleshoot system, wiring, and connectivity issues as needed
  • Educate customers on the proper use of their security system and mobile applications
  • Complete job documentation, inventory tracking, and equipment verification accurately
  • Maintain a professional presence in customers’ homes at all times
  • Ensure installations are completed correctly the first time to avoid return visits (“go-backs”)
  • Follow company installation standards, safety guidelines, and quality expectations
